Transaction 95bc2ed38f58682ff7854444ac79d1e240edd8586bf5a686ab19db1f88b583ab
1 Input
2 Outputs
- 95bc2ed38f58682ff7854444ac79d1e240edd8586bf5a686ab19db1f88b583ab:0
- 95bc2ed38f58682ff7854444ac79d1e240edd8586bf5a686ab19db1f88b583ab:1
value 29862521
address 1BVrzb8kwFDfVz4jHgpYKEoCMcFxUcz5o5
value 17782663
address 16c7hUKkqPt4tBqA8kqiBtNw9XN2Ucm6p9